Abstract:Up-conversion phosphors have attracted considerable attention for their visible-light emission. In this study, a ZnO-TiO 2 up-conversion phosphor containing Yb 3+ and Er 3+ ions was prepared; its emission characteristics and crystal structure were analyzed, and its nanoscale elemental mapping was examined. The metal organic decomposition (MOD) method was used to fabricate the samples.
